1881 - Iowa's earliest measurable snow of record fell over western sections of the state. Four to six inches was reported between Stuart and Avoca.

Endville (also, Enville) is an unincorporated community in Pontotoc County, Mississippi, United States.
A post office operated under the name Endville from 1900 to 1904.
On April 27, 2011, a tornado hit Endville as part of the 2011 Super Outbreak. The tornado was rated EF0, with estimated wind speeds of 70 mph (110 km/h; 61 kn). The tornado downed several trees and damaged a couple of houses; its path of destruction was 75 yards (69 m) wide and the tornado travelled a path of 1.02 miles (1.64 km).
